It's not really the walking dead, the original title of the episode is 'Night of the living Homeless', the episode is more of an homage to George A. Romero's iconic zombie movies: Night of the Living Dead, Dawn of the Dead and Day of the Dead. The Walking dead comic book series started coming out in 2003 and George A. Romero did release his found footage chapter in the franchise 'Diary of the Dead' the year this episode came out (2007). But the TV show of the walking dead wouldn't be released for another 3 years.

The way the people all said "chaaange" makes me think this was a parody of Russo's "Return of the Living Dead" as well as Romero's "Dawn of the Dead." If you haven't watched "Return of the Living Dead" then I highly recommend it. It's a great movie to do a "first time watching" reaction video for if you're interested in that. Russo and Romero worked together on the original "Night of the Living Dead" and then split. While Romero continued playing it straight with his "of the Dead" movies, Russo took a more comedic approach with his "Living Dead" movies.
